begin process at 2012 02 09 15:57:51
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ive C/C++

 > 

Archives

 > 

Au secours

 > 

while if


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

while if

mardi 31 janvier 2006 à 15:47:11 | while if

snoopydo

Membre Club

Bonjour ,

Je dois rediger un ti programme qui calcule la paie hebdomadaire d'un employe a partir du nombre d'heures travaillees et du salaire horaire ( au dela de 40 heures, toute heure supplementaire equivaut a une heure et demie ).
tout ca rien qu'avec while if else break continue .
mon prob est surment tout bete mais je trouve pas .

j'ai ecris un truc du genre ...

int salaire_horaire ;
int heure;

int main()
{
cout"Veuillez entrer le nombre d'heure travaillees svp "<<"\n";
cin>>heure;
cout<<"Veuillez entrer le salaire horaire svp "<<"\n";
cin>>salaire_horaire;
if(heure  >=40 )
    prime  = ((heure * salaire_horaire)+((heure>=40 * minute) * salaire_horaire))
    cout<<"Votre paie est egale a "<<prime<<"\n";
}
    else
    prime = (heure * salaire_horaire);
    cout<<"Votre paie est egale a "<<prime<<"\n";
    system("PAUSE");

    return EXIT_SUCCESS;
}

mardi 31 janvier 2006 à 15:52:02 | Re : while if

snoopydo

Membre Club

re  ai relu un peu le code et me suis rendu compte que ca tiend po la route mais c'est tjs pas bon  .

if(heure  >=40 )
    prime  = (heure * salaire_horaire)+(heure>=40 * salaire_horaire)
    cout<<"Votre paie est egale a "<<prime<<"\n";
}
    else
    prime = (heure * salaire_horaire);
    cout<<"Votre paie est egale a "<<prime<<"\n";

mardi 31 janvier 2006 à 16:32:14 | Re : while if

BruNews

Administrateur CodeS-SourceS
if(heure > 40) {
  int sup;
  sup = heure - 40;
  paie = 40 * taux + sup * (taux * 1.5);
}

n'oublie pas les cast en double.

ciao...
[ Lien ]
BruNews, MVP VC++
mardi 31 janvier 2006 à 16:35:35 | Re : while if

ymca2003

Réponse acceptée !
if(heure  >=40 ) 
{
    prime  = (heure*salaire_horaire)+(((heure-40)*salaire_horaire*3)/2)
    cout<<"Votre paie est egale a "<<prime<<"\n";
}
else
{
    prime = (heure * salaire_horaire);
    cout<<"Votre paie est egale a "<<prime<<"\n";
}
mardi 31 janvier 2006 à 16:37:51 | Re : while if

TeniX

Membre Club
Salut,

ton calcule de la prime me semble en declarant prime en flotant bizare essay:

prime = ((float)(heure-40)*1.5)*(float)salaire_horaire;

j'ai pas tester.
mardi 31 janvier 2006 à 18:16:26 | Re : while if

snoopydo

Membre Club

manque juste un  ;  apres 
prime  = (heure*salaire_horaire)+(((heure-40)*salaire_horaire*3)/2)   ; <---------- point virgule et faut le   declarer ds les variable .

sinon ai test les deux autres soluces mais ai po chercher a comprendre pourquoi ca allaient pas .
grand merci .



Cette discussion est classée dans : int, while, heure, salaire, horaire


Répondre à ce message

Sujets en rapport avec ce message

aidez moi svp [ par asnow ] Q'un aurait-il la gentillesse de me traduire ce code, en algorithme. merci d'avance.int i=0;int x=random(10);int y=random(10);int type_pos=random(2);i Problème incompréhensible [ par JosueClement ] Regardez plutot...Ce programme est une sorte d'horloge!Il n'y a aucune erreur de compilation, mais les heures n'augmentent jamais!!A la ligne 54, j'ai cosinus [ par anek971 ] Bonjour ,ben avt de demander de l'aide j'ai chercher sur le forum mais ya pas le programme en c.Et en faite c juste pr une verification car mon progra interface de jeu [ par cafou ] sltest ce que qu'elqu'un peut me propose une interphase graphique et des animations au jeu en language c si dessousmerci d'avance#include#include#incl Petite question de débutant While && [ par Nicolas67 ] j?ai un soucis dans le While le ?? n?est pas pris en compte.while ((inValeur1Temp!=0 && inValeur2Temp!=0));je veux qu?il tourne DO jusqu?à ce inValeur Affichage de int dans une CString [ par ekinox17 ] voila j'aimerai afficher l'heure dans mon prog MFC : bon je l'ai fait sa marche mais ya un truc que je sais pas faire : mon affichage donne ceci 11:9: Problème d'Affichage [ par temac ] Bonjour,j'ai un petit problème. J'ai un code où il y a trois options en fonctions de l'argument choisi. De façon indépendante elles marchent mais une resoudre un problème [ par ihssann ] j'ais un projet à fiare ; j'ais fais le code meis il ne veux pas executer!!!!qu'est ce que je dois faire svp??voila mon code: #include <SPAN lang=EN-G heure GTM [ par maladedede ] BonjourComme idée pour améliorer le site je propose que l'on demande lors de l'inscription le fuseau horaire de l'utilisateur.Et que l'heure dans le f Afficher heure [ par maxlog ] Bonjour, J'aimerais savoir comment afficher l'heure de mon serveur (mon Ordi) avec la commande 'date'... J'ai affiché la date mais je voudrais mainten


Nos sponsors


Sondage...

CalendriCode

Février 2012
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
272829    

Consulter la suite du CalendriCode

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 5,756 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ales